Abstract
A new and distinct variety of rose plant, referred to by its cultivar name, ‘MEIJOVAUX’, is disclosed. The new variety forms attractive, semi-double creamy pink with a creamy yellow center colored flowers. Attractive rather dense with a semi-glossy aspect foliage is formed, which contrasts beautifully with the blossoms. A ground cover growth habit is displayed. The new variety is well suited for providing attractive ornamentation in the landscape.

We claim: 1. A new and distinct variety of rose plant named ‘MEIJOVAUX’ characterized by the following combination of characteristics: (a) provides a ground cover growth habit with procumbent vegetation, (b) forms semi-double creamy pink with a creamy yellow center colored flowers, and (c) exhibits a semi-glossy foliage; substantially as herein shown and described.
